have a look at how you can change what bits are black and white using the lightroom conversion, you can alter how say all the reds in your image appear, the blues etc. Getting a properly developed digital B&W is a proper art

not really. What you do in lightroom changing the mix etc is just like using colour filters on an enlarger to produce the final print. Granted, composing a shot to produce a good B&W, you need a good mix of contrasts, and textures in your composition - and this comes with time.
